Information on EC 2.4.2.21 - nicotinate-nucleotide-dimethylbenzimidazole phosphoribosyltransferase and Organism(s) Salmonella typhimurium and UniProt Accession Q05603

IUBMB Comments
Also acts on benzimidazole, and the clostridial enzyme acts on adenine to form 7-alpha-D-ribosyladenine 5'-phosphate. The product of the reaction, alpha-ribazole 5'-phosphate, forms part of the corrin-biosynthesis pathway and is a substrate for EC 2.7.8.26, adenosylcobinamide-GDP ribazoletransferase . It can also be dephosphorylated to form alpha-ribazole by the action of EC 3.1.3.73, alpha-ribazole phosphatase.
